Output 24c132057c220f96e68f4a77c2a38a7cbcf4c4d3082b68a90ed688f876480862:130

value
13300
script pubkey
OP_0 OP_PUSHBYTES_20 edbabd66a928f990aae43942b761fc996dca0d2c
address
bc1qakat6e4f9ruep2hy89ptwc0un9ku5rfveqvcdj
transaction
24c132057c220f96e68f4a77c2a38a7cbcf4c4d3082b68a90ed688f876480862
spent
true